ASM Handbook Volume 18: Friction, Lubrication, and Wear Technology

ASM Handbook Volume 18: Friction, Lubrication, and Wear Technology

Product Description

"A significant, comprehensive and convenient reference on wear processes and prevention of damage."

Sections include:

  • Solid Friction - introduction, basic theory, frictional heating calculations, lab testing methods for solid friction, measuring and modeling during metal forming.
  • Lubricants and Lubrication - liquid lubricants, lubrication regimes, lubricant additives and their functions, solid lubricants (grease), applications.
  • Wear - wear by particles or fluids, by rolling/sliding/impact, chemically-assisted wear, monitoring and diagnosis.
  • Laboratory Characterization Techniques - characterization of roughness and wear scar dimensions, microscopy, micromechanical properties, thermal/chemical/x-ray methods.
  • Systematic Diagnosis of Test Data - basic tribological parameters, design of experiments, presentation of data, concepts of reliability and failure modes.
  • Friction and Wear Components - bearings/gears/seals, transportation system components, industrial and mining machinery, medical and dental materials, electrical contacts, semiconductors.
  • Materials for Friction and Wear Applications - ferrous and nonferrous metals and alloys, ceramics and composites, carbon-base materials and polymers.
  • Surface Treatments and Coatings - surface finishes and patterned surfaces, thermal spray coatings, electroplated coatings, PVD and CVD coatings, ion implantation, laser surface processing, carburizing, nitriding.

Published: 1992
Pages: 942
